What companies run services between Blandford Forum, England and London Victoria Station, England?

South Western Railway operates a train from Poole to London Waterloo hourly. Tickets cost £45–110 and the journey takes 2h 10m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Seldown Coach Station to London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£22–55 and the journey takes 3h 50m.
